PRISM: Distribution-Gated Flow Matching for Controllable Unpaired Image Translation

PRISM: Distribution-Gated Flow Matching for Controllable Unpaired Image Translation

Quick summary

arXiv:2608.06240v1 Announce Type: cross Abstract: Unpaired image-to-image translation must decide, per image, what to change and what to preserve without paired supervision. Many diffusion-based unpaired translators control preservation through a single global noise or guidance value applied across the image, which cannot separate content to keep from appearance to change. We present PRISM, a GAN-free flow-matching framework that replaces this global control with a learned per-feature gate.
